Hi - I just installed a 120GB hard drive and an aladdin advance xt chip in a V1.0 xbox. I formatted the hard drive with slayers, as I'm lazy and it does a decent job. So it works just fine with the chip enabled - boots into evox and everything. Works fine when you have a game in the dvd-rom and the chip isn't enabled - but if you don't have a game in it, and the chip isn't turned on - it locks up at a green screen, where you can see a slight grid pattern in the background (I can't remember what this screen is for)
Any ideas what is wrong? I've heard something about the time not getting set properly - or something like that... Can't quite remember though... Thanks for your help! |

basically its an error with the way slayers installs M$ dash on some hard drives. To fix that issue simply reinstall M$ dash via FTP. I get this error all the time when I use slayers.
